Thank you for being part of our community and for the care and curiosity you bring to what we grow and make. Each seasonal release is a snapshot of place and time, and we are glad to share these bottles with you. Your winter wine club allocation includes:

2023 Mineral Springs White Label Chardonnay - Barrel fermented with extra lees and aged 18 months in bottle, the second release of our Mineral Springs White Label Chardonnay arrives with a gorgeous gold color and a glint of green. It opens with ripe apple, baked pear, a whisper of caramel, toasted crust, and warm spice, while a current of bright acidity lifts the luxurious texture and carries flavors of apple, mineral, and spice through a long, lingering finish. Equally at home over a slow meal or quietly evolving in the cellar, this is a wine that rewards patience.

2024 Soter Savannah Ridge Pinot Noir - The 2024 Savannah Ridge is generous and inviting from the first pour, offering a graceful aromatic lift of red fruits, dried flowers, and a savory herbal spice that runs throughout. On the palate, bright red fruit flavors are shaped by an elegant, silky texture and a lively acidity that keeps everything in motion, carrying through to a juicy, energetic finish. Of the three wines in this release, this is the most immediately expressive, approachable and complete from the start, yet built with enough balance and vitality to reward those who choose to wait. Best drinking: 2027 to 2030.

2024 Soter Ribbon Ridge Pinot Noir - The 2024 Ribbon Ridge is a wine of quiet depth and old-world character. It opens to scents of dark bramble, cola, and an iron-edged minerality that is very much its own, with a predominant blackberry fruitiness at its core. In the mouth, that fruit persists and expands, wrapped in a texture that is rustic and structured in the best sense, with dusty tannins and a dark, brambly persistence that gives the wine a beguiling and lasting charm. This is a wine that rewards patience, both in the glass and in the cellar, unfolding gradually for those willing to give it a moment. Best drinking: 2027 to 2030.

    • Thursday, June 4th โ€“ via Hybrid Temp Control* 

      *This method protects your wine using a combination of refrigerated transportation from Oregon to a hub closer to you. At the hub, ice packs will be added to environmentally friendly, insulated wine shipping boxes, and from there the wine will be shipped out via Ground for delivery for a protected, shorter transit during the warm season.
